- Away from cities a man puts up a watermelon stall. Rare local drivers pass by without stopping. Only tourists stop to have a picture taken in front of such a peculiar sight. Such a business can hardly bring profit. To make things worse another seller puts up his stall opposite from him. The film shows a day in the life of watermelon seller.

- A car drives through Poland. The scenery gradually changes: a town, high-rise flats and farmhouses. The car stops in a village. A female photographer from Western Europe gets out and avidly takes pictures of her surroundings. By chance, her eye is caught by the arrival of a wedding party. This marks the point of departure for several stories which unfold during the course of the wedding.

- A story about a family of nomadic goat herders living on the fringes of the Sahara. We see their difficult lives and daily struggles with their animals, the weather, and their search for water. Nonetheless, they live in harmony with their surroundings, and the rhythms of nature are firmly etched in their nomadic way of life. However, the lack of water and strong winds put their traditions to the test. As evening falls, a storm is approaching...
